Richard T. Tipton CIH, CSP

Rick founded Safe Day Consulting, LLC in 2002 and is one of the principal industrial hygiene and occupational safety consultants.  He has more than 20 years experience in safety and health program development and operation.  He has extensive experience in the automotive industry with General Motors, aerospace industry with The Boeing Company, semiconductor industry with MEMC Electronic Materials, and in the chemical and pharmaceutical services industries with Solutia.  His experience is at all levels in the organizational structure from plant industrial hygienist to corporate occupational safety and health manager.  He has obtained significant international experience over his career and has extensive experience in developing and implementing safety and health data management systems.

Education:
M.S.    Env. Science/Industrial Hygiene    University of Oklahoma    
B.S.    Agriculture                    Oklahoma State University   

Certifications:
Certified Industrial Hygienist    #5057        1990
Certified Safety Professional #12533        1994

Affiliations:
American Industrial Hygiene Association
American Society of Safety Engineers

Michael L. Siegel, CIH

 

Mike is an industrial hygiene, occupational safety and emergency response preparedness consultant. He has more than 20 years experience in safetyand health program development and field investigation. He has over 15 years experience as a Firefighter and Chief Officer, and as a hazardous material responder with a regional response team. He has extensive experience in the chemical and pharmaceutical industry, agricultural sites, light industrial and construction with Monsanto and Solutia. His experience is at several levels in the organization and includes field investigation, risk assessment, safety and health program/procedure development and exposure assessment.  Mike has significant emergency response experience as an industrial responder as well as in the community. He is a hazardous material specialist level responder and is an active member of the Jefferson County Regional Homeland Security Response Team. He has assisted in coordination and training of its members and has conducted training for regional responders in several counties.

 

Education:

M.S. Industrial Hygiene           Central Missouri State University

B.S. Industrial Safety               Central Missouri State University

A.A.S. Chemical Technology   St. Louis Community College – Florissant Valley

 

Certifications:

Certified Industrial Hygienist   #6826            1995

Certified Fire Officer II – Missouri   #1021-1997

Certified Fire Instructor II – Missouri   #1041-1987

Emergency Medical Technician (EMT-B) – Missouri #B-45166

 

Affiliations:

American Industrial Hygiene Association

Health Physics Society

Fire Department Safety Officers Association

Rhonda L. Kauffman, CIH, CSP, CHSP

 

Rhonda Kauffman has over twenty years of diversified experience in Industrial Hygiene and Occupational Safety and Health, with a thorough knowledge of Workers' Compensation Insurance and  practical knowledge and application of OSHA regulations.  She has worked as an environmental consultant, a staff industrial hygienist for a major medical center, and as a Loss Prevention Consultant in the insurance industry.  She has extensive experience in providing specialized safety and health consultations for large, complex customers as well as developing and presenting various safety and health related training topics

 

Education:

B.S. Toxicology, 1985 – Northeast Louisiana UniversitySafeDayLogo2

 

Certifications:

Certified Industrial Hygienist   #6921          

Certified Safety Professional   #14419

Certified Healthcare Safety Professional   #531
